    Q:   Can I join Hindustan University without entrance exam?
    A: 

    No, Hindustan University offers admission to all of its courses based on a valid score in the respective entrance exams. For the majority of UG courses from the streams of Science, Commerce, Humanities, Management and Law, the university conducts an in-house entrance exam, i.e., HITSCAT. For BTech course, students can apply via HISEEE, which is also an in-house entrance exam of Hindustan University. Apart from that, students can also get admission to various national level entrance exams such as CLAT/ GATE/ UGC NET, for specific courses. To find course-wise details for the accepted entrance exam, click here.

    Q:   Does Hindustan University have entrance exam?
    A: 

    Yes, Hindustan University conducts two entrance exams at the university level, i.e., HITSEEE and HITSCAT for all the UG and PG courses. The HITSEEE exam is popularly conducted for BTech admission and it is conducted in two phases. The HITSCAT exam is mandatory for the rest of the UG and PG courses. For PhD admission, the university accepts admission through UGC NET/ GATE valid score.

    Q:   Does Hindustan University offer any integrated course in BSc?
    A: 

    Yes, Hindustan University offers a five-year integrated course of BSc + MSc across three specialisations, namely Food Technology, Visual Communication and Mathematics. In this integrated course, students get a combined degree of UG and PG after the completion of course.

    Q:   Is Hindustan University good for Law?
    A: 

    Hindustan University offers a three-year LLB course as a professional program. This course is approved by the Bar Council through the School of Law. At Hindustan University, students get to learn the fundamentals of Law with real-time situations and practical implementations. During the commencement of this course, students get wide exposure to industry collaboration with associations such as Surana and Surana International Attorneys, which is associated with the ILSA. It is popular to conduct many national and international moot court competitions. The university also provides international opportunities where students can do one Semester Exchange Program at Chicago University. Find the students' reviews for this course here.
